Coastguards in Peel were called out earlier this week after a woman injured herself on Peel Hill.
She was walking there on Monday afternoon, but shortly before 3pm she slipped on wet grass and injured her ankle.
Coastguards and paramedics reached her near Corrins Folly, lifted her into a stretcher and carried her to safety.
The incident lasted around an hour and a half.
